EMCOR Group Inc
INDUSTRIALS · ENGINEERING & CONSTRUCTION · USA
EMCOR Group, Inc. provides electrical and mechanical installation and construction services in the United States. The company is headquartered in Norwalk, Connecticut.
Waters Corporation
HEALTHCARE · DIAGNOSTICS & RESEARCH · USA
Waters Corporation is a publicly traded Analytical Laboratory instrument and software company headquartered in Milford, Massachusetts.
